[01/11] drm/i915: Introduce drm_i915_gem_request_node for request tracking

Message ID 1450093012-14955-1-git-send-email-chris@chris-wilson.co.uk (mailing list archive)
State New, archived
Headers show

Commit Message

Chris Wilson Dec. 14, 2015, 11:36 a.m. UTC
In the next patch, request tracking is made more generic and for that we
need a new expanded struct and to separate out the logic changes from
the mechanical churn, we split out the structure renaming into this
patch. For extra fun, create a new i915_gem_request.h.

Signed-off-by: Chris Wilson <chris@chris-wilson.co.uk>

It's the same as before. Instead of explicitly named functions to call
on retiring, you have a list of callbacks.
 
> Also I notice even though you later add vma->last_read, I don't see
> that obj->last_read is never removed.

Why would it? obj is for the GEM api, vma is for internal - they have
different lifetimes and track different state as I thought I explained.
